A wood kitchen table flatpack can be made at a workbench (Wooden workbench or better) in the workshop of a player-owned house. This requires 12 Construction, uses 3 planks and 3 nails, and gives 87 experience. The flatpack can then be used on the table hotspot in the Kitchen while in building mode. This requires no Construction level and gives no experience.
The cost of making and selling a wood kitchen table flatpack from scratch gives a profit of: -2,905. This assumes the nails did not break, and steel nails (highest nail available at sawmill) were used.
After completing the hard Fremennik achievements, they can also be traded to Advisor Ghrim in exchange for 59 coins being added to your kingdom's coffers in Miscellania. See Flatpack: Miscellania reselling for details.
